Transaction ec55defc9b23055ca14f806e20856d7a88a5b1de7dbabf114187849b069acfc6
1 Input
1 Output
-
ec55defc9b23055ca14f806e20856d7a88a5b1de7dbabf114187849b069acfc6:0
- value
- 628576
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 092545c85addb8cc933ec38f27856320f41cd54b OP_EQUAL
- address
- 32XNf1pxVaBeJSx72762mm7BFsuHgEh99R